在现代供应链管理中,采购跟单信息追溯系统扮演着至关重要的角色。该系统不仅能够帮助企业实时监控采购订单的执行情况,还能确保供应链的透明度和效率。本文将探讨采购跟单信息追溯系统的架构设计,旨在提供一个高效、可靠的解决方案。
系统架构设计的核心在于确保数据的准确性、实时性和可追溯性。为此,我们可以采用分层的架构设计,包括数据层、服务层和应用层。
数据层是整个系统的基础,负责存储所有与采购订单相关的数据。这包括供应商信息、订单详情、物流信息等。为了确保数据的一致性和完整性,可以采用关系型数据库管理系统(RDBMS)如MySQL或PostgreSQL。这些系统能够提供强大的数据完整性保障和事务管理功能。
服务层作为中间件,负责处理业务逻辑和数据交互。它可以由一系列微服务组成,每个微服务负责处理特定的业务功能,如订单创建、订单跟踪、库存管理等。微服务架构的优势在于其灵活性和可扩展性,可以根据业务需求快速调整和扩展服务。
应用层则是用户与系统交互的界面。它可以包括Web前端和移动应用,提供用户友好的操作界面。前端应用需要能够展示实时的订单状态,以及提供搜索、过滤和报告功能。为了实现这一点,可以采用现代的前端框架如React或Vue.js,它们能够提供响应式设计和丰富的用户交互功能。
在设计系统时,还需要考虑到系统的安全性和隐私保护。这包括数据加密、用户身份验证和授权机制。系统还需要能够处理异常情况,如网络故障或数据不一致,以确保业务连续性。
系统的可扩展性和灵活性也是设计时需要考虑的重要因素。随着业务的增长,系统需要能够轻松地添加新的功能和服务。因此,采用模块化设计和容器化部署(如Docker)可以提高系统的可维护性和可扩展性。
系统的用户体验也是不可忽视的。一个直观、易用的用户界面可以大大提高工作效率,减少操作错误。因此,设计时需要充分考虑用户的需求和操作习惯,提供个性化的界面和功能。
通过上述架构设计,采购跟单信息追溯系统能够为企业提供强大的数据支持和业务流程管理,从而提高供应链的透明度和效率。
文章推荐: